An unannounced monitoring inspection was conducted today, October 24, 2023 as a focused follow-up to the issuance of a conditional license. The inspector was on site from approximately 10:10 am until 12:15 pm. The owner/ director was present and assisted with the inspection. There were seven children present, ranging in ages from three to four years, with three staff supervising. Children were observed finishing snack while listening to a story. Later children had time outside on the playground where they played with bubbles, rode small trikes, and painted bags to make pumpkins. Staff interacted with children in a positive manner.
The inspector reviewed compliance in the areas of administration, physical plant, staffing and supervision, programming, medication, special care and emergencies and nutrition. A total of five child records and three staff records were reviewed.
Information gathered during the inspection determined non-compliance with applicable standards or law and violations were documented on the violation notice issued to the program.

Violations:
Standard #: 22.1-289.035-B-4
Description: Based on review of three staff records, the center did not obtain the results of a criminal history record information check and a search of the child abuse and neglect registry or equivalent registry from any state in which one staff member had resided in the preceding five years.

Evidence:

1) The record for Staff #2, employed 09/07/2023, indicated the staff had resided in three additional states outside of Virginia within the last five years.
2) The record for staff #2, employed 09/07/2023, did not contain a criminal history record information check or a search of the child abuse and neglect registry for the three additional states.
3) The out-of-state criminal history record information check is required to be obtained prior to hire. The out-of-state search for founded complaints of child abuse or neglect is required to be requested within the first 30 days of being employed.
4) The director confirmed the required out-of-state checks were not requested for Staff #2.

Plan of Correction: Per the director: Background request will be submitted .

Standard #: 8VAC20-780-160-A
Description: Based on review of three staff records, the center did not obtain documentation of a
negative tuberculosis screening for one staff member within the required time frame.

Evidence:

1. The record for Staff #2 (Employment 09/07/2023) contained documentation of a
negative tuberculosis screening dated 06/26/2023.
2.Tuberculosis screenings are required to be completed no more than 30 calendar days prior to employment and submitted at the time of employment.

Plan of Correction: Per the director: Going forward, we will get TB's prior to employment and within no more than 30 days prior to employment.

Standard #: 8VAC20-780-240-B
Description: Based on review of three staff records and interview, the center did not ensure two staff completed orientation training prior to the staff member working alone with children and no later than seven days of the date of assuming job responsibilities.

Evidence:

1. The record of staff #1, employed 09/05/2023, did not contain documentation of orientation training.
2. The record of staff #2, employed 09/07/2023, did not contain documentation of orientation training.
3. The director stated staff #1 and staff #2 worked alone with children and had not completed the orientation training.

Plan of Correction: Per the director: We will make it a priority to complete missing documentation for the staff records
